Not really. There is no honeymoon leave for marriage, and the only holidays prescribed by the state are marriage leave. Marriage leave is a holiday that employees can enjoy according to the national law, and those who marry according to the legal age (female 20 years old, male 22 years old) can enjoy 3 days of marriage leave.

However, those who get married during the family leave period will not be given another marriage leave, and family leave includes public leave and statutory holidays.

If you work for a shorter period of marriage leave, you can also apply to the company for paid annual leave to use for your honeymoon. General companies have paid annual leave, according to the different years of work, the number of paid annual leave is also different. Before asking for leave, you can check the relevant regulations of the company for paid annual leave.

However, whether it is marriage leave or paid annual leave, you should apply with the company in advance, and handle the work at hand before taking a vacation, otherwise it will delay the company's affairs, but also make yourself unable to relax on the honeymoon.
